souslesens / souslesensVocables

SousLeSensVocables is a set of tools to manage semantic web thesaurii and ontologies (SKOS,OWL,RDF)
MIT License
14 stars 9 forks source link

Bug build SLS-PY-API #595

Closed claudefauconnet closed 8 months ago

claudefauconnet commented 8 months ago

Claude Fauconnet claude.fauconnet@gmail.com 08:35 (il y a 54 minutes) À Xavier

Building sls-api Step 1/11 : FROM docker.io/library/python:3.11-alpine 3.11-alpine: Pulling from library/python 661ff4d9561e: Already exists 44cda88cd45d: Pull complete 2cbca0db7eef: Pull complete 5c03c2d36281: Pull complete f3eb635f7e92: Pull complete Digest: sha256:b9cc19c4f422bd75cfcbef7b6ea563270629da3fd8652c4f9ec94217ce1a9693 Status: Downloaded newer image for python:3.11-alpine ---> d624407390d5 Step 2/11 : RUN apk add --no-cache poetry ---> Running in 87b97f783fca fetch https://dl-cdn.alpinelinux.org/alpine/v3.19/main/x86_64/APKINDEX.tar.gz fetch https://dl-cdn.alpinelinux.org/alpine/v3.19/community/x86_64/APKINDEX.tar.gz (1/91) Installing libgcc (13.2.1_git20231014-r0) (2/91) Installing libstdc++ (13.2.1_git20231014-r0) (3/91) Installing mpdecimal (2.5.1-r2) (4/91) Installing python3 (3.11.6-r1) (5/91) Installing python3-pycache-pyc0 (3.11.6-r1) (6/91) Installing pyc (3.11.6-r1) (7/91) Installing py3-poetry-plugin-export (1.6.0-r0) (8/91) Installing py3-poetry-plugin-export-pyc (1.6.0-r0) (9/91) Installing py3-parsing (3.1.1-r0) (10/91) Installing py3-parsing-pyc (3.1.1-r0) (11/91) Installing py3-packaging (23.2-r0) (12/91) Installing py3-packaging-pyc (23.2-r0) (13/91) Installing py3-pyproject-hooks (1.0.0-r1) (14/91) Installing py3-pyproject-hooks-pyc (1.0.0-r1) (15/91) Installing py3-build (1.0.3-r0) (16/91) Installing py3-build-pyc (1.0.3-r0) (17/91) Installing py3-msgpack (1.0.7-r0) (18/91) Installing py3-msgpack-pyc (1.0.7-r0) (19/91) Installing py3-certifi (2023.7.22-r0) (20/91) Installing py3-certifi-pyc (2023.7.22-r0) (21/91) Installing py3-charset-normalizer (3.3.2-r0) (22/91) Installing py3-charset-normalizer-pyc (3.3.2-r0) (23/91) Installing py3-idna (3.6-r0) (24/91) Installing py3-idna-pyc (3.6-r0) (25/91) Installing py3-urllib3 (1.26.18-r0) (26/91) Installing py3-urllib3-pyc (1.26.18-r0) (27/91) Installing py3-requests (2.31.0-r1) (28/91) Installing py3-requests-pyc (2.31.0-r1) (29/91) Installing py3-cachecontrol (0.13.1-r0) (30/91) Installing py3-cachecontrol-pyc (0.13.1-r0) (31/91) Installing py3-crashtest (0.4.1-r2) (32/91) Installing py3-crashtest-pyc (0.4.1-r2) (33/91) Installing py3-rapidfuzz (3.5.2-r0) (34/91) Installing py3-rapidfuzz-pyc (3.5.2-r0) (35/91) Installing py3-cleo (2.1.0-r0) (36/91) Installing py3-cleo-pyc (2.1.0-r0) (37/91) Installing py3-dulwich (0.21.6-r0) (38/91) Installing py3-dulwich-pyc (0.21.6-r0) (39/91) Installing py3-installer (0.7.0-r1) (40/91) Installing py3-installer-pyc (0.7.0-r1) (41/91) Installing py3-zipp (3.17.0-r0) (42/91) Installing py3-zipp-pyc (3.17.0-r0) (43/91) Installing py3-importlib-metadata (7.0.0-r0) (44/91) Installing py3-importlib-metadata-pyc (7.0.0-r0) (45/91) Installing py3-more-itertools (10.1.0-r0) (46/91) Installing py3-more-itertools-pyc (10.1.0-r0) (47/91) Installing py3-jaraco.classes (3.3.0-r0) (48/91) Installing py3-jaraco.classes-pyc (3.3.0-r0) (49/91) Installing py3-jeepney (0.8.0-r3) (50/91) Installing py3-jeepney-pyc (0.8.0-r3) (51/91) Installing py3-cparser (2.21-r4) (52/91) Installing py3-cparser-pyc (2.21-r4) (53/91) Installing py3-cffi (1.16.0-r0) (54/91) Installing py3-cffi-pyc (1.16.0-r0) (55/91) Installing py3-cryptography (41.0.7-r0) (56/91) Installing py3-cryptography-pyc (41.0.7-r0) (57/91) Installing py3-secretstorage (3.3.3-r2) (58/91) Installing py3-secretstorage-pyc (3.3.3-r2) (59/91) Installing py3-keyring (24.2.0-r0) (60/91) Installing py3-keyring-pyc (24.2.0-r0) (61/91) Installing py3-ptyprocess (0.7.0-r5) (62/91) Installing py3-ptyprocess-pyc (0.7.0-r5) (63/91) Installing py3-pexpect (4.9-r0) (64/91) Installing py3-pexpect-pyc (4.9-r0) (65/91) Installing py3-pkginfo (1.9.6-r1) (66/91) Installing py3-pkginfo-pyc (1.9.6-r1) (67/91) Installing py3-platformdirs (4.0.0-r0) (68/91) Installing py3-platformdirs-pyc (4.0.0-r0) (69/91) Installing py3-requests-toolbelt (1.0.0-r0) (70/91) Installing py3-requests-toolbelt-pyc (1.0.0-r0) (71/91) Installing py3-shellingham (1.5.4-r0) (72/91) Installing py3-shellingham-pyc (1.5.4-r0) (73/91) Installing py3-tomlkit (0.12.3-r0) (74/91) Installing py3-tomlkit-pyc (0.12.3-r0) (75/91) Installing py3-trove-classifiers (2023.11.29-r0) (76/91) Installing py3-trove-classifiers-pyc (2023.11.29-r0) (77/91) Installing py3-distlib (0.3.7-r2) (78/91) Installing py3-distlib-pyc (0.3.7-r2) (79/91) Installing py3-filelock (3.12.4-r0) (80/91) Installing py3-filelock-pyc (3.12.4-r0) (81/91) Installing py3-virtualenv (20.24.6-r0) (82/91) Installing py3-virtualenv-pyc (20.24.6-r0) (83/91) Installing poetry-pyc (1.7.1-r0) (84/91) Installing py3-fastjsonschema-pyc (2.19.0-r0) (85/91) Installing py3-lark-parser (1.1.7-r0) (86/91) Installing py3-lark-parser-pyc (1.1.7-r0) (87/91) Installing py3-poetry-core-pyc (1.8.1-r0) (88/91) Installing python3-pyc (3.11.6-r1) (89/91) Installing py3-fastjsonschema (2.19.0-r0) (90/91) Installing py3-poetry-core (1.8.1-r0) (91/91) Installing poetry (1.7.1-r0) Executing busybox-1.36.1-r15.trigger OK: 101 MiB in 129 packages Removing intermediate container 87b97f783fca ---> b23ce0a3b9f8 Step 3/11 : WORKDIR /src ---> Running in a2d35469e0e9 Removing intermediate container a2d35469e0e9 ---> 41624f3be9e4 Step 4/11 : COPY poetry.lock pyproject.toml README.md /src/ ---> 4cd625893b32 Step 5/11 : RUN poetry install ---> Running in 36c77f0e91ff Creating virtualenv sls-api-VsnhxLU2-py3.11 in /root/.cache/pypoetry/virtualenvs Installing dependencies from lock file

Package operations: 38 installs, 0 updates, 0 removals

• Installing idna (3.6) • Installing six (1.16.0) • Installing sniffio (1.3.0) • Installing typing-extensions (4.8.0) • Installing annotated-types (0.6.0) • Installing anyio (3.7.1) • Installing isodate (0.6.1) • Installing pydantic-core (2.14.5) • Installing pyparsing (3.1.1) • Installing certifi (2023.11.17) • Installing charset-normalizer (3.3.2) • Installing click (8.1.7) • Installing h11 (0.14.0) • Installing httptools (0.6.1) • Installing iniconfig (2.0.0) • Installing mypy-extensions (1.0.0) • Installing packaging (23.2) • Installing pathspec (0.11.2) • Installing platformdirs (4.0.0) • Installing pluggy (1.3.0) • Installing pydantic (2.5.2) • Installing python-dotenv (1.0.0) • Installing pyyaml (6.0.1) • Installing rdflib (7.0.0) • Installing starlette (0.27.0) • Installing urllib3 (2.1.0) • Installing uvloop (0.19.0) • Installing watchfiles (0.21.0) • Installing websockets (12.0) • Installing black (23.11.0) • Installing colorlog (6.7.0) • Installing pytest (7.4.3) • Installing python-multipart (0.0.6) • Installing sparqlwrapper (2.0.0) • Installing requests (2.31.0) • Installing fastapi (0.104.1) • Installing python-ulid (2.2.0) • Installing uvicorn (0.24.0.post1)

Installing the current project: sls-api (0.2.0) The current project could not be installed: No file/folder found for package sls-api If you do not want to install the current project use --no-root

Removing intermediate container 36c77f0e91ff ---> 566012a1f624 Step 6/11 : COPY sls_api /src/sls_api ---> ff70eda3d7d2 Step 7/11 : RUN poetry install ---> Running in 90b1f657f605 Installing dependencies from lock file

No dependencies to install or update

Installing the current project: sls-api (0.2.0) Removing intermediate container 90b1f657f605 ---> 8e50dfe9bcf3 Step 8/11 : COPY config.ini.default /src/config.ini ---> e6e06372487a Step 9/11 : EXPOSE 8000 ---> Running in a16c37c44e0e Removing intermediate container a16c37c44e0e ---> ece4d0094600 Step 10/11 : COPY --chmod=755 entrypoint.sh /entrypoint.sh ERROR: Service 'sls-api' failed to build: the --chmod option requires BuildKit. Refer to https://docs.docker.com/go/buildkit/ to learn how to build images with BuildKit enabled root@vps-5ef950f8:/var/lib/sls/souslesensVocables#

xgaia commented 8 months ago

Il faut mettre à jour Docker pour utiliser buildKit

https://docs.docker.com/engine/install/ubuntu/#install-using-the-repository